Market Analysis · ZIP 91331

What the Data Shows

87% of residents in ZIP 91331 identify as Hispanic or Latino. Tax offices serving this part of Los Angeles operate primarily in Spanish and need tools built for that expectation — not English-first platforms with a translation layer bolted on. With 63 active tax offices, preparer density in ZIP 91331 is below the city average — which means there is more room to grow a client base here than in higher-competition ZIPs.

Spanish Speakers

87% of ZIP 91331 residents speak Spanish at home, confirming strong demand for Spanish-language tax services in this area.

Limited English

37% speak English less than "very well" — a direct indicator of how important native-Spanish tools are for reaching this client base.

Poverty Rate

17% of residents fall below the poverty line — a population where EITC maximization has the most direct financial impact.

Opportunity Score · ZIP 91331

Market Opportunity Assessment

71
High Opportunity

out of 100 · weighted composite score

The 71/100 opportunity score reflects above-average Hispanic concentration (87%), below-average competition (63 offices) — a strong combination for a bilingual tax office looking to grow.

The opportunity score weights: Hispanic market concentration (30%), EITC filing rate (25%), returns-per-household density (20%), and inverse preparer density — lower competition = higher score (25%). Scores are min-max normalized across all ZIPs in the dataset.
